River Slope Protection Cement Blanket (also known as Concrete Cloth) is a flexible cement-based composite material specifically designed for water conservancy projects such as irrigation channels, drainage ditches, and riverways. Its primary functions include rapid lining, seepage prevention, erosion resistance, and slope protection.
I. Core Features (Advantages for Channel Applications)
1. Excellent flexibility — perfectly adapts to complex terrain.
Remains soft and fabric-like before curing, allowing bending, folding, and cutting; perfectly conforms to curved, trapezoidal, steep-sloped, and irregular channel profiles.
2. Extremely fast installation — no formwork required.
· On-site procedure only involves: unroll → secure → hydrate.
· Initial set in 2 hours, ready for use in 24 hours, and reaches near full strength within 7 days.
· Reduces construction time by over 70% compared to traditional concrete.
3. Seepage Resistance and Durability
· After hardening, forms a dense concrete layer with excellent impermeability, freeze-thaw resistance, and resistance to acids and alkalis.
· Resists water erosion and penetration by plant roots.
· Service life of 10 to 30 years.
4. Lightweight and Cost-Effective
· Weighs only 1/10 that of traditional cast-in-place concrete.
· Significantly reduces transportation, labor, and machinery costs.
